Response:On October 20 2015, Ms. [redacted] brought her vehicle to our shop to get her vehicle inspected for leaks. After inspection, we discovered that she had multiple leaks, including leaks from the transmission pan gasket, crank angle sensor, cam shaft position sensor, and a possible leak from the front timing cover of her Mercury Sable. Ms. [redacted] approved the repairs for replacing the transmission pan gasket, crank angle sensor, and the cam shaft position sensor. At that time, she declined repairs for the front timing cover. It was explained to her that she would still have a leak from that front timing cover. She was originally given an estimate of $700.54 for these repairs, but was only charged a total of $472.10. On October 29 2015, Ms. [redacted] returned to our shop proclaiming that she still had a leak from her vehicle. After once again inspecting the vehicle, we found that there was no longer leaks coming from her transmission pan, but was in fact from the front timing cover. At that time, we then recommended replacing the timing chain cover, oil pan gasket, and valve cover gasket totaling $1357.54 but repairs were declined once again. She was not charged for this inspection. The owner offered Ms. [redacted] a discount to repair all of the leaks, which she at first approved. We then received a phone call from her the following morning, telling us not to continue with the repairs. We have all of the supporting documentation regarding this particular case, and we are sorry that we will not be able to help Ms. [redacted] with her repairs.
